Understanding NIW Green Cards in Hodgenville, KY
The National Interest Waiver (NIW) is a special option within U.S. immigration law that enables esteemed unique individuals to bypass the usual requirements of a permanent position offer or PERM labor certification. It is within the EB-2 visa classification, which is predominantly for professionals holding advanced degrees or exceptional ability individuals.
NIWs are for immigrant visa applicants who can show their work is important and will greatly benefit the United States, warranting the waiver of the standard employer sponsorship requirements. Are You Eligible for an NIW? Consult an Immigration Lawyer in Hodgenville, KY
The NIW category is intended for those who either hold an advanced degree or exhibit exceptional ability — and whose employment would benefit the United States. For an approvable petition , you need to prove your work holds substantial intrinsic merit in fields like medicine, business, tech, and education. Furthermore, your proposed endeavor must also possess substantial national importance and not be relevant to only Hodgenville, KY or other localities. Lastly, you need to prove that the impact your work will have on the nation surpasses the interest of prioritizing U.S. workers for these positions.

Green card petitions in Hodgenville, KY that are self-filed are complicated, and the NIW application is no exception. You need to satisfy intricate criteria just to qualify for an NIW, and you must also gather and present a significant quantity of supporting evidence. You’ll need to provide supporting documentation to the I-140 form, which include persuasive recommendation letters from co-workers or other esteemed individuals in the field, a current CV outlining your background, a personal statement, documented proof of your significant contributions (awards, presentations, patents, publications, etc.) and more.
